简单游脚本怎么写?如何实现高效运行?
作者:半梦心殇 来源:超变下载站 时间:2025-09-30 03:55:44
简单游脚本编写指南及高效运行策略
一、引言
随着游戏行业的蓬勃发展,简单游脚本编写成为了许多游戏开发者和爱好者关注的焦点。一个优秀的简单游脚本不仅能够提升游戏体验,还能提高开发效率。本文将详细介绍简单游脚本的编写方法以及如何实现高效运行。
二、简单游脚本编写指南
1. 确定游戏类型和目标
在编写简单游脚本之前,首先要明确游戏类型和目标。例如,是休闲游戏、角色扮演游戏还是策略游戏?游戏的目标是娱乐、教育还是社交?明确这些有助于后续脚本的编写。
2. 设计游戏规则
游戏规则是游戏的核心,决定了游戏的玩法和玩法逻辑。在设计游戏规则时,要考虑以下因素:
(1)游戏目标:明确游戏胜利条件,如得分、通关等。
(2)游戏玩法:设计游戏角色、道具、关卡等元素,以及它们之间的互动。
(3)游戏难度:根据目标受众调整游戏难度,确保游戏既具有挑战性,又不会过于困难。
3. 编写脚本
编写脚本时,要遵循以下原则:
(1)模块化:将脚本分解为多个模块,便于管理和维护。
(2)简洁明了:使用简洁、易懂的语言描述脚本逻辑。
(3)可读性:使用有意义的变量名和函数名,提高代码可读性。
(4)注释:对关键代码进行注释,方便他人理解和维护。
以下是一个简单的脚本示例:
```javascript
// 游戏初始化
function initGame() {
// 初始化游戏角色、道具、关卡等元素
// ...
}
// 游戏开始
function startGame() {
// 游戏开始逻辑
// ...
}
// 游戏结束
function endGame() {
// 游戏结束逻辑
// ...
}
// 游戏循环
function gameLoop() {
while (true) {
// 游戏逻辑
// ...
// 判断游戏是否结束
if (isGameOver()) {
endGame();
break;
}
}
}
// 主函数
function main() {
initGame();
startGame();
gameLoop();
}
// 调用主函数
main();
```
4. 测试与优化
编写完脚本后,要进行充分的测试,确保游戏运行稳定。在测试过程中,根据反馈对脚本进行优化,提高游戏性能。
三、如何实现高效运行
1. 优化算法
选择合适的算法可以显著提高游戏性能。例如,使用空间换时间的方法,减少重复计算;使用动态规划、贪心算法等优化算法,提高游戏效率。
2. 优化资源
合理使用游戏资源,如图片、音频、视频等,可以降低游戏运行时的内存占用。以下是一些建议:
(1)使用压缩技术:对图片、音频、视频等资源进行压缩,减小文件大小。
(2)按需加载:在游戏运行过程中,根据需要加载资源,避免一次性加载过多资源。
(3)缓存机制:对常用资源进行缓存,减少重复加载。
3. 优化代码
优化代码可以提高游戏性能。以下是一些建议:
(1)避免全局变量:使用局部变量,减少变量查找时间。
(2)减少循环嵌套:尽量减少循环嵌套,提高代码执行效率。
(3)使用高效的数据结构:根据实际情况选择合适的数据结构,如数组、链表、树等。
四、相关问答
1. 问题:如何提高简单游脚本的执行效率?
回答:提高简单游脚本的执行效率可以通过优化算法、优化资源、优化代码等方面实现。例如,使用高效的数据结构、减少循环嵌套、按需加载资源等。
2. 问题:编写简单游脚本时,需要注意哪些问题?
回答:编写简单游脚本时,需要注意游戏类型和目标、游戏规则设计、脚本模块化、简洁明了、可读性、注释等方面。
3. 问题:如何确保简单游脚本运行稳定?
回答:确保简单游脚本运行稳定,需要对脚本进行充分的测试,根据反馈进行优化。同时,注意优化算法、资源、代码等方面,提高游戏性能。
总结
简单游脚本的编写和高效运行对于游戏开发具有重要意义。通过遵循上述指南,可以编写出高质量、高性能的简单游脚本。希望本文对您有所帮助。
- 上一篇: MM1314是什么?它有什么用途?
- 下一篇: 没有了